Saver Royal Blue Blend opens with cardamom that feels warm and slightly resinous. It does not bite or turn sharp. The spice sits close to the skin and sets a steady tone that carries through the first part of the wear. It gives the fragrance a clear direction from the start.
Leather enters next and takes over the center of the composition. It is smooth and dark, with a texture that feels dry rather than oily. The cardamom stays nearby and keeps the spice present while the leather deepens. The two notes work together without one overshadowing the other.
Amber forms the base and adds weight to the blend. It brings a golden warmth that rounds out the leather and prevents the dry edges from feeling too stark. The result is a fragrance that feels steady and composed. The animalic and smoky facets in the accords add further depth without pushing the scent into heavy territory.
The mood fits a cool evening when the air is crisp and the light is low. A man who likes leather and amber done with a warm spicy touch will find this composition a natural choice for those darker hours.
